The United States has long been one of the world’s largest producers and consumers of natural gas. As technology advances and environmental concerns grow, the future of natural gas reserves becomes a critical topic for policymakers, industry leaders, and consumers alike.
Current State of Natural Gas Reserves
As of 2023, the United States holds substantial natural gas reserves, primarily located in shale formations such as the Marcellus, Utica, and Haynesville. These reserves have contributed to the country’s energy independence and economic growth. However, the rate of extraction and the longevity of these reserves depend on technological, economic, and environmental factors.
Technological Advancements and Their Impact
Innovations in hydraulic fracturing and horizontal drilling have unlocked vast reserves previously considered inaccessible. Continued technological improvements could extend the life of existing reserves and make new areas economically viable. However, these methods also raise environmental concerns, such as groundwater contamination and seismic activity.

Environmental and Policy Considerations
Environmental concerns and climate change policies are influencing the future of natural gas. While natural gas is often viewed as a cleaner alternative to coal and oil, its extraction and use still emit greenhouse gases. Policies aimed at reducing carbon emissions may limit future exploration and production.

Future Outlook
The future of natural gas reserves in the United States will depend on balancing technological progress, environmental sustainability, and economic needs. While current reserves are significant, their longevity may be challenged by policy shifts and societal preferences for cleaner energy sources.
Investments in renewable energy and cleaner alternatives are likely to shape the energy landscape in the coming decades. Natural gas may continue to play a transitional role, but its long-term viability hinges on sustainable practices and effective regulation.
